May 3, 2010 Mr. Brett Colston Assistant Chief of Police Waxahachie Police Department 216 North College Waxahachie, Texas 75165 OR2010-06294 Re: Request for a copy of the search warrants, arrest warrants, affidavits, 911 calls, squad car video, surveillance video & mug shots related to the incidents at a specified location on April 7, 2010 at 7 pm Dear Mr. Colston: The Office of the Attorney General has received your request for a ruling and assigned your request ID# 384151. After reviewing your arguments and the submitted recording, we have determined your request does not present a novel or complex issue. Thus, we are addressing your claims in a memorandum opinion. You claim the submitted information may be withheld from the requestor pursuant to section 552.108(a)(2) of the Government Code. We have considered your arguments and the submitted information and have determined that in accordance with section 552.108(a)(2) you may withhold the submitted information. We assume you have released the rest of the requested information. See Gov't Code §§ 552.301, .302. Lastly, the submitted report is not responsive tot he request, and this decision does not address it.
